Rightclicking on response plots gives access to a variety of options and annotations. Transfer function models are illsuited for numerical computations. The last bode plot you will ever make charles nippert this set of notes describes how to prepare a bode plot using mathcad. Plottingcalculating transfer functions ptc community. In the previous page, the numbering starts with n0. If the function is not defined on this interval, mathcad plots only the regions where the function is defined. For example, you can compare sets of data, track changes in data over time, or show data distribution. Therefore, in this paper, i will try my very best to explain to you the concept of the mathcad tool. Drawing bode plots the last bode plot you will ever make. H is just the way to call what is the transfer matrix of my system. Using mathcad to obtain bode plots and nyquist plots of transfer functions. An uncertain size limit on the variables you can transfer into the excel sheet forcing you to. The softwares easeof use gets you started quickly, but its powerful features and unitsaware math notation let you create and document complex calculations that can be verified and shared with colleagues.
Ptc mathcad, the somewhat robust legacy build, has been halted at v15. Transferfunctionmodelm, s represents the model of the transferfunction matrix m with complex variable s. Mathcad 14 3d plot of transfer function martin, in case you are still with us and prefer a simpler variant, see attached. Create separate line plots in the axes by specifying the axes object as the first argument to plot3. If desired, you can group all four responses on a single plot by rightclicking on the plot and selecting the io grouping all submenu. Matlabs tfestimate will produce a numerical estimate of the magnitude and phase of a transfer function given an input signal, an output signal, and possibly other information. Define the range of frequencies as powers of 10, i. In these notes we will draw the bode plots of a second order transfer function. Here is the outline of the mathcad tool that i will cover in this paper. A transfer function will be developed for these blocks or.
Using the transfer function in octave, you can use the control package function step to calculate the transient response for you rather than performing the inverse laplace transform yourself. The following additional plots are useful for analyzing mimo systems. Bode plot from given transfer function in mathcad prime. At that time, it was first to use mathematical notation with automatic computation. So once you have zs, stepz will produce or plot the transient response. The fast fourier transform university of connecticut. You can also have time delays in your transfer function representation. Call the nexttile function to create the axes objects ax1 and ax2. A polar plot can show several r expressions against the same 8 expression, or it. The addin features a 3d plot wizard, easy mapping between excel ranges and mathcad variables, automatic recalculation, and online help.
Using mathcad to obtain bode plots and nyquist plots of. Transferfunctionmodelz, p, g, s specifies the zeros z, poles p, and gain g of a transferfunction model. Follow these instructions to draw bode plot for any transfer function. This document derives the various transfer functions for the tcs1 system on the irtf. Using mathcad to obtain bode plots and nyquist plots of transfer using mathcad to obtain bode plots and nyquist.
Passing the function as a character vector or string. You may receive emails, depending on your notification preferences. If the vectors are not the same length, mathcad will plot the number of elements in the shorter vector. One instance where this can occur is if show markers is selected, but no values have been entered.
Mathcad plots all the elements in the vector x against the elements in the vector y. Numerical solutions of ordinary differential equations. If you just enter the function as above, and put y and x on the axes of a plot, mathcad just highlights the x in red which means variable undefined any mathcad experts out there. Mathcad 2b6a when an xy plot is printed, everything else comes out the axis labels, numbers etc, but the trace itself does not. You cant plot a complex number versus two independent variables you would need four axes what you can do is.
Combine a contour plot and a quiver plot using the hold function. I tried to stay close to what you tried but you should keep in mind that you may have better control using methods like createmesh as shown by andy. When call step without output arguments, it plots the step response on the screen. Matlab crack 2018 free download with key matlab programming.
Singular value plot sigma, which shows the principal gains of the frequency response. Transfer functions are normally used to introduce a nonlinearity after a parameterized layer like linear and spatialconvolution. Plotting a magnitude and phase bode plot plots in mathcad. Mathcad prime 6 does what spreadsheets, word processing and presentation software simply cannot do. Array multiplication, division, and exponentiation are always implied in the expression you pass to ezplot3.
Plottingcalculating transfer functions hi liam, im not really fluent in prime, more so in mathcad since version 2, so it took me a lot of time to build this, the interface appears to be intuiitive, but isnt always if you start using it. How to plot a 2d parametric equation matlab answers. Not recommended easytouse 3d parametric curve plotter. Ptc mathcad allows you to experience enhanced calculation power with faster, more accurate solutions and comprehensive worksheets. In some cases, you may prefer to explicitly tell mathcad which elements of the vectors to plot.
This is useful when you want to only plot some of elements. Ptc mathcad is the industry standard software for solving, analyzing, and sharing your most vital engineering calculations. How to properly plot a response of a transfer function in. What i want is to plot the terms on the diagonal of that matrix and in this case i used the h1,1 one because i supose that knowing how to represent that will carry me to represent the rest without problem. Control system toolbox software supports transfer functions that are continuoustime or discretetime, and siso or mimo. Nonlinearities allows for dividing the problem space into more complex regions than what a simple logistic regressor would permit. Mathcads program function and application in mathcad is one of popular computer algebra system math software in the world. This worksheet is used to solve 6 equations 100 times and then plot each species as a function of the overlying partial pressure of h. Ptc offers a limited version that is totally free, named ptc mathcad express. Creating a simple x y plot of raw data on mathcad step 1 on the tool bar go to insert and then component and then input table step 2 click on finish and a table appears with two columns.
In particular, the characteristics menu lets you display standard metrics such as rise time and settling time for step responses, or peak gain and stability margins for frequency response plots using the example from the previous section, plot the closedloop step response. You can then convert the resulting models back to transfer function form for inspection purposes. Ptc mathcad prime, the build for the future, is currently at v3. The order of the numerator and denominator is relatively high so that when i plot the phase of the transfer function using arg or angle, phase reverses direction suddenly. The tf model object can represent siso or mimo transfer functions in continuous time or. Analysis of impulse response for a linear system processes the impulse response to obtain a frequencydomain transfer function, which is then used to solve for the response to an arbitrary driving function. Notice that the independent variable has not been defined previously. The result of this numerical method will be a mathcad function that you will use to draw a graph and display a table of results. Transferfunctionmodelwolfram language documentation. Some of the enhanced formatting capabilities you can expect include. Step 1 decide the starting and finishing values of time for the plot and the intervals at which you. Im trying to display the output response of a transfer function in mathematica with and without a compensator. Call the tiledlayout function to create a 1by2 tiled chart layout.
Tutorial showing how to plot a function in mathcad. Alternatively, you could create a function that takes a complex number, take the real or imaginary part and stacks it with zero then plot the result directly. To find the frequency components, take the fast fourier transform of v using the built in fft function of mathcad. Click on the graph once if show markers is on, you will see 2 placeholders on either the x or y axis, or both.
Plot continuous, discrete, surface, and volume data. The mathcad addin for microsoft excel lets you add mathcad calculations and plots to your excel worksheets with full access to worksheet data. Using mathcad to plot graphs suppose you wish to plot v 2 sin. Its live mathematical notation, units intelligence, and powerful calculation capabilities, presented within an easytouse interface, allows engineers and design teams to capture and communicate their critical design and engineering knowledge. I realized that the mathcad tool does help me to solve the homework faster and cleaner. Mathcad 2020 portable torrent is an engineering tool which performs validation, verification, documentation process perfectly. Does anyone know how to plot an implicit function in mathcad. User defined functions and plots in mathcad 15 duration. It also shows how to use mathcads math style feature.
The system is broken down into blocks in a visio document. It uses simple, familiar maths notation to create and edit your equations, automatically calculating as you go no more unintuitive nested functions or commandline instructions. Unless you specify a time range to plot, step automatically chooses a. By default, if the independent variable is not defined, mathcad uses 10 to 10. Transfer functions transfer function representations. It was initially introduced in 1986 by dos operating system.
Create a transfer function model and plot its response to a step input at t 0. The farreaching impact of matlab and simulink explore the wide range of product capabilities, and find the solution that is right for your application or industry. Introduction to mathcad mathcad is as versatile and powerful as programming languages, yet it is as easy to learn as a spreadsheet. Bode plots are plots of the magnitude of a complex transfer function in decibels versus frequency and the phase in degrees as a function of frequency. Fundamental functions of mathcad, including simple calculations, defining variables, entering text, defining function, graphs. This matlab function plots the spatial curve x xt, y yt, and z zt over the default domain 0. For instance, consider a continuoustime siso dynamic system represented by the transfer function syss nsds, where s jw and ns and ds are called the numerator and denominator polynomials, respectively.
1084 1449 85 183 1311 1478 597 841 1522 638 1519 1571 137 1175 560 273 1312 1203 557 1326 151 579 769 984 557 477 63 891 235